The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"git: найти где был удален текст"
Вариант для распечатки  
Пред. тема | След. тема 
Форум Программирование под UNIX (Контроль версий, Git, SVN, Bazaar, Mercurial)
Изначальное сообщение [ Отслеживать ]

"git: найти где был удален текст"  +/
Сообщение от Azimuth (ok) on 11-Май-12, 18:09 
Пожалуйста, помогите найти коммит, в котором был удален текст. Знаю текст и имя файла.

git log -Sнужный_текст --name-only : Вообще не показывает файл в котором содержался этот текст.

git log -p | grep нужный_текст: Выводит много чего лишнего (строки, но не коммиты): удаленный текст - имя функции из cpp файла, на основе которого генериться несколько файлов для gSOAP, которые раньше зачем-то лежали в репозитории

git log -p -- имя_файла | grep нужный_текст ни чего не выводит

Ответить | Правка | Cообщить модератору

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"git: найти где был удален текст"  +/
Сообщение от Andrey Mitrofanov on 11-Май-12, 18:42 
> git log -Sнужный_текст --name-only : Вообще не показывает файл в котором содержался
> этот текст.

У меня показывает. Два коммита - и где добавлен, и где удалён. ??

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

2. "git: найти где был удален текст"  +/
Сообщение от Аноним email(??) on 25-Май-12, 01:36 
> Пожалуйста, помогите найти коммит, в котором был удален текст. Знаю текст и
> имя файла.
> git log -Sнужный_текст --name-only : Вообще не показывает файл в котором содержался
> этот текст.
> git log -p | grep нужный_текст: Выводит много чего лишнего (строки, но
> не коммиты): удаленный текст - имя функции из cpp файла, на
> основе которого генериться несколько файлов для gSOAP, которые раньше зачем-то лежали
> в репозитории
> git log -p -- имя_файла | grep нужный_текст ни чего не выводит

Попробуйте указать принудительно имя файла:
$ git log -S'текст для поиска' -- путь/к/файлу

должно найти и показать все коммиты, в которых менялся указанный текст в указанном файле

Ответить | Правка | ^ к родителю #0 |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2025 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ру